Of the scores of beneficial herbs that are native to Australia, Lemon Myrtle is one of the best known and most popular. The herb has been a part of a traditional Aboriginal diet for over 40,000 years as a flavouring agent and medicinal aid.  Native Indigenous Australians often wrapped Lemon Myrtle leaves in paperbark and used it to add flavour to fish and various other meals. They would also crush and inhale the herb as a natural remedy for treating health issues such as headaches, muscle pain, wounds and stress. Why Lemon Myrtle Is Known as the Queen of Australian Herbs Due to its high purity, health benefits, and long history of medicinal usage, Lemon Myrtle is often hailed as the Queen of Australian Herbs. Among all the citrus herbs and fruits, Lemon Myrtle has the highest citral purity. This fragrant compound has powerful anti-microbial and anti-inflammatory properties, along with the potential to promote weight loss.  In a study published in the Indian Journal of Pharmacology, citral has been shown to reduce insulin sensitivity and glucose tolerance, leading to a reduction in weight gain. Lemon Myrtle is also rich in antioxidants, such as Vitamin C, that help prevent the production of free radicals, reduce oxidative stress, support a healthy immune system, and promote overall wellness and rejuvenation. From there, your shares will be issued, and Birchal will transfer the money to us to use in our future business plans which are outlined in the Offer Document.   An Equity Crowdfunding investment is like planting a Eucalyptus tree in that it’s a medium-term to long-term commitment. Shares in the companies who raise through Birchal cannot be easily transferred or sold as they are not traded through public exchanges (i.e. the ASX). Due to this, your shares are generally considered to be 'illiquid' so you may not be able to sell your shares quickly if you need the money or decide that this investment is not right for you.   However, there are numerous possible circumstances that may create an opportunity for you to "exit" your investment (i.e. sell your shares) or otherwise receive returns. Such as: a trade sale of the company to another company the company proceeds with an Initial Public Offering (IPO) and listing on a registered stock exchange (e.g. the ASX) the company organises a buyback of the shares a private sale of your shares to another person the company pays shareholder dividends.  The options available to shareholders will be mentioned in our company Offer Document at the time of investment, but we can’t guarantee that any of the above options will occur. Our hope is that our company value will have increased in the event of an ‘exit’, so when that time comes hopefully your shares will have gone up in value!   You may lose your entire investment, and you should be in a position to bear this risk without undue hardship. Even if the company is successful, the value of your investment and any return on the investment could be reduced if the company issues more shares. Ask questions, read all information given carefully, and seek independent financial advice before committing yourself to any investment.   You can invest as an individual, trust or company (including SMSF)   Crowdsourced Equity Funding (also known as Equity Crowdfunding) is governed by legislation that is covered by ASIC (RG 261) and can only be facilitated through licensed intermediaries (ie. birchal.com).   The normal rules apply to your investment in a company via CSF when it comes to tax-time, and we recommend investors consult with an accountant depending on their unique circumstances. If the company on Birchal offering the shares is an E.S.I.C (early stage innovation company), there may be tax incentives for you as an investor.
